Information Technology Minister Mukkur N. Subramanian, who has been denied a party ticket in this election, was criticised for neglecting the campaign for Polur AIADMK candidate at the party workers meeting on Friday.
C.M. Murugan has been given a ticket by AIADMK in the constituency.
Speakers said that it was Mr. Subramanian who recommended Mr. Murugan, but he has not turned up in Polur to conduct workers meeting or to give thrust to campaign ever since the candidate was announced. Polur MLA L. Jayasudha echoed the sentiment.

But Peranamallur block secretary Selvaraj was vociferous in his criticism.
Incidentally, Mr. Subramanian participated in the workers meeting in Tiruvannamalai on Friday.
